Abstract :
Microblog is one of the most typical applications on Web 2.0 Internet. It enables its users to publish their own microblogs and also facilitates tracking microblogs of other users. There are many microblog websites on Internet, including Twitter, G+, Sina microblog, and Shanghai Xinmin. As huge numbers of users participate microblog websites, an ever-increasing scale of information is added into these websites. This paper measures Shanghai Xinmin microblog website, and reveals behavior of its users as well as corresponding social structure among its users.
